Young Leadership Programme 2020: Mediterranean forests in urbanised societies
The economic, social and environmental challenges of today need bright new thinking that will shape tomorrow. EFI’s Young Leadership Programme targets the leaders of that future, bringing young professionals together with experts to create a new space where change can happen.
